Abstract
A -density wave (ddw) order of electron in two-dimensional t-J model is analyzed in saddle point level using the U(1) slave boson formalism. We considered not only the staggered flux (s-flux) order of spinon but also the s-flux order of holon. This analysis provides the relation between the s-flux order of spinon and the ddw order of electron. We discovered a new phase in the phase diagram. In this phase, there is a s-flux order of spinon, but no ddw order of electron.Our results are that 1) a region of electron ddw exists, 2) there is no coexistence of ddw and -wave pairing (singlet-RVB) in all region of phase diagram, and that 3) the ground state is a purely wave superconducting state.
